How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 97217?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 97217 Studio Apartments | $1,366 | $899 | $3,803 |
| 97217 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,812 | $875 | $5,438 |
| 97217 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,599 | $1,270 | $6,461 |
| 97217 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,421 | $1,515 | $9,904 |
| 97217 4 Bedroom Apartments | $11,242 | $2,895 | $14,661 |
